목록전체 글 (370)
hy30nq's blog
보호되어 있는 글입니다.
보호되어 있는 글입니다.
보호되어 있는 글입니다.
보호되어 있는 글입니다.
보호되어 있는 글입니다.

안녕하세요 여러분! 😊 오늘은 PHP에서 발생할 수 있는 연산자 취약점에 대해 이야기해볼게요. 특히, 위의 코드 예시를 통해 이런 취약점이 어떻게 발생하는지 알아보고, 이를 예방하는 방법에 대해 자세히 설명드릴게요.연산자 취약점이란?PHP에서 연산자 취약점은 서로 다른 데이터 타입을 비교할 때 발생할 수 있어요. 예를 들어, 문자열과 정수를 비교할 때 예상치 못한 결과가 나올 수 있답니다. 이로 인해 보안 문제가 발생할 수 있죠. 특히, PHP는 느슨한 타입 언어라서 이러한 취약점이 더 쉽게 발생할 수 있어요.코드 예시 분석먼저 주어진 코드를 살펴볼게요.$input_id = '0';$id = 'sdf2dfkewq';if((int)$input_id == $id) { echo "babo";}이 코드는..

안녕하세요, 여러분! 오늘은 curl -o 옵션에 대해 알아보려고 해요. curl은 다양한 인터넷 프로토콜을 활용해 데이터를 전송할 수 있는 명령어인데요, 특히 파일 다운로드할 때 유용하게 쓰인답니다. 그 중에서도 -o 옵션을 사용하면 파일을 지정한 이름으로 저장할 수 있어요. 그럼, 자세히 살펴볼까요?1. curl -o 옵션이란?-o 옵션은 curl 명령어를 사용할 때 다운로드한 파일을 지정한 파일 이름으로 저장하는 데 사용해요. 기본적으로는 curl이 URL에서 데이터를 가져와 화면에 출력하지만, -o 옵션을 사용하면 파일로 저장할 수 있어요.2. 사용법간단하게 curl 명령어 뒤에 URL과 -o 옵션, 저장할 파일 이름을 입력하면 돼요.curl [URL] -o [파일이름]3. 예시다음은 https:..

안녕하세요! 😊 오늘은 파이썬의 class에 대해 아주 상세하게 설명해드리려고 해요. 파이썬의 클래스는 객체 지향 프로그래밍(Object-Oriented Programming, OOP)의 핵심 개념 중 하나랍니다. 예제를 통해 차근차근 알아볼게요.파이썬 클래스의 모든 것1. 클래스란?클래스는 객체를 생성하기 위한 틀(템플릿)이라고 할 수 있어요. 클래스는 속성과 메서드를 가질 수 있고, 이를 이용해 여러 개의 객체를 생성할 수 있어요.2. 클래스 정의하기클래스를 정의하려면 class 키워드를 사용해요. 간단한 예제로 살펴볼게요.class Dog: # 클래스 속성 species = "Canis familiaris" # 초기화 메서드 (생성자) def __init__(self, nam..